I am working on a drawing template. (Btw, I am thankful to have this functionality!) There are a few things that I have noticed and want to ask about.
- I see a way to insert a logo in the titleblock, but it currently only accepts raster formats (JPEG, PNG, etc.). Is there a way to add a vector file (such as DXF, AI, or SVG)? If not, can this be added, please?
- There is a bit of wonkiness with the text editor. If one double-clicks on an attribute, the entire attribute text will be selected. Pressing Delete or Backspace on the keyboard works as expected and deletes the attribute text. If one double-clicks on a text field, however, pressing Backspace does nothing and pressing Delete exits from the text editor and starts the delete geometry command. This neither seems logical nor intentional.
- Can we add the ability to enter custom attributes? I am envisioning something like the way AutoCAD handles these.
